An old washing 'machine' on display outside Harleston Museum. It is located outside the museum and is free to view any time, even outside of museum opening hours.
No makers name immediately obvious. This may have been on a plate on the front of the 'tub'. A simple design, a galvanised bin with a wooden lid with a handle for mixing the wash - a spin cycle of 1600rpm would have been some task! On top is a simple mangle for wringing out the wet washing.
